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Stirling to Billericay start from as little as £42.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Stirling to Billericay start from £97.50 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Stirling to Billericay are available for £125.40 one way

Facilities and Services at Stirling Station

Stirling Train Station is well-equipped with modern facilities to cater to travelers' needs. The ticket office operates Monday to Saturday from 6:20 AM until 9:00 PM, and on Sundays from 8:50 AM to 10:00 PM, allowing ample time to purchase or collect your tickets. For those who prefer the ease of digital transactions, you’ll find ticket machines, including accessible ones, within the station premises. The station is outfitted with smartcard validators though it doesn't issue smartcards on-site.

Passenger support is excellent, with assistance available from early morning until midnight and help points located strategically around the station. Comfort is ensured with waiting rooms available throughout the day, supplemented by seating areas and accessible toilets. For those needing a break, there are refreshment facilities including WH Smith and a café, plus vending machines ensuring you won't go hungry. Amenities extend to include an ATM and even bicycle hire services through Nextbike, offering an eco-friendly way to tour the city.

Accessibility is a priority at Stirling station. Travelers with reduced mobility will appreciate the step-free access throughout the station and facilities like ramps, accessible ticket machines, and waiting rooms. Additionally, there's a dedicated area for assistance meeting points at the Automatic ticket gates. Further, there are 10 dedicated blue badge parking spaces for those arriving by car, ensuring convenience for everyone.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Billericay Train Station is well-equipped to ensure a smooth and hassle-free journey. The ticket office operates from as early as 6:00 AM till the evening, making it convenient for early risers and night owls to plan their travel. For added ease, ticket machines are available along with facilities for collecting tickets purchased online. And for those who prefer to travel smart, smartcards can be issued and validated at the station.

Accessibility is prioritized here with step-free access to all platforms, although the lifts are locked between 20:15 and 06:00. The station offers accessible parking spaces, induction loops, and even step-free waiting rooms, ensuring everyone can travel with ease. Refreshments and an ATM machine are on hand to make your waiting time pleasant and productive.

Transport Links

Venturing beyond the station is simple with an array of transport links. A taxi rank is conveniently located at the station, perfect for those who want to hop into a cab. If you prefer buses, 'First' operates frequent services to local areas. With a Billericay PLUSBUS ticket, you can enjoy unlimited bus travel around town, combining train and bus travel with extra savings. Substitute bus services are readily available at the station entrance should rail replacements be required.
